解题思路:从第4楼梯开始,每个楼梯的上法等于其上一个楼梯上法加其上第3个楼梯的上法
注意事项:
参考代码:
#include<stdio.h>
int main()
{
int a[21],n;
int i;
a[1]=a[2]=1;
a[3]=2;
for(i=4;i<=20;i++)
a[i]=a[i-1]+a[i-3];
while(scanf("%d",&n)!=EOF){
if(n>0&&n<=20)
printf("%d",a[n]);
}
return 0;
}
0.0分
3 人评分
点我有惊喜!你懂得!浏览:1392 |
C语言程序设计教程(第三版)课后习题11.5 (C语言代码)浏览:654 |
简单的a+b (C语言代码)浏览:719 |
上车人数 (C语言代码)浏览:816 |
【亲和数】 (C语言代码)浏览:541 |
C语言程序设计教程(第三版)课后习题1.6 (C语言代码)浏览:732 |
C语言程序设计教程(第三版)课后习题4.9 (C语言代码)浏览:727 |
蚂蚁感冒 (C语言代码)浏览:1408 |
大家好,我是验题君浏览:604 |
第三届阿里中间件性能挑战赛-总决赛亚军比赛攻略浏览:1170 |